Helsinki Boat-Afloat Show

Date: 13 August 2026 – 16 August 2026

Location: Helsinki Marina, Helsinki, Finland

Uiva, the Helsinki Boat-Afloat Show, is the largest floating boat show in the Nordic countries. The 2026 show runs 13 to 16 August at the HSK marina (Helsingfors Segelklubb) in Lauttasaari, a short hop from central Helsinki, with a free shuttle bus from Lauttasaari metro station during opening hours. Close to 300 boats are typically on display, most of them in the water: sailboats, motorboats and fishing boats you can step aboard, plus engine, electronics and equipment stands on land. The in-the-water format is what separates Uiva from the indoor Helsinki International Boat Show held in winter. Here you see how a boat actually sits and behaves afloat, which matters more than any spec sheet. The late-summer timing is deliberate, aimed at buyers weighing decisions for the next season. Opening hours are 11am to 7pm from Thursday to Saturday and 11am to 6pm on Sunday.
